The Power of Chia Seeds
The star of this dish is the humble chia seed. These tiny black or white seeds are nutritional powerhouses. When soaked in liquid, they form a gel-like consistency, creating a creamy pudding without any cooking. This unique property is what makes chia pudding so effortless. But their benefits go far beyond texture. Chia seeds are packed with fiber, which aids digestion and helps keep you feeling full for longer, preventing mid-morning snack attacks. They are also a fantastic source of plant-based prot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and essential minerals like calcium and magnesium. This impressive nutritional profile contributes to sustained energy release, helping you avoid the sharp energy spikes and crashes associated with high-sugar breakfasts.
Your Basic Blueprint
Creating your own chia berry layers is incredibly easy and requires no culinary expertise. The basic ratio is your starting point, and from there, you can adjust to your preferred consistency. For a single serving, start with 2 tablespoons of chia seeds and a half cup of liquid. Whisk them together in a jar or bowl, ensuring there are no clumps. For the liquid, you have plenty of options: regular dairy milk, almond milk, coconut milk, or even a mix of milk and yogurt for extra creaminess. Let this mixture sit for at least a couple of hours, or preferably overnight in the refrigerator, to allow the seeds to fully absorb the liquid and 'bloom'. For the berry layer, simply mash a handful of fresh or thawed frozen berries. Layer the chia pudding and berry mash in a jar, and your breakfast is ready.
Make It Uniquely Yours
While berries are a classic and delicious choice, this breakfast is a blank canvas for your creativity. Think beyond strawberries and blueberries and embrace local and seasonal fruits. A layer of sweet mango puree, grated apple with a pinch of cinnamon, or even mashed banana can provide a delightful twist. Don't be afraid to add a touch of Indian flavour with a pinch of cardamom powder in your chia mix. The liquid you choose also plays a big role in the final taste; coconut milk lends a tropical note, while regular dairy milk offers a classic, creamy base. For toppings, the options are endless: a sprinkle of chopped nuts like almonds or pistachios, a dash of pumpkin or sunflower seeds for crunch, or a handful of granola. These additions not only enhance the flavour but also boost the nutritional value.
